Reusable and removable insulation blankets and covers can be divided into 3 main components:
An outer layer, designed to shield and protect the insulation from the environment in which it finds itself.
The middle insulation layer. Thicknesses vary from ½” up to 4,” depending on the amount of heat reduction the application requires.
The inner layer, which helps to keep the middle insulation mat in place and may also act as a barrier to protect the insulation mat from fluid seepage.

Common fastening methods include:
Stainless steel lacing wire
Straps
Stainless Steel Springs
Snaps
Velcro - hook and loop fasterner
